    Postponing the community Christmas dinner at the American Legion Hall in Boothbay until the day after Christmas did not wane the spirits of over 60 people who attended Tuesday, Dec. 26. Dinner started at noon and many escaped the bitter cold into the hall filled with Robert Moore’s melodious Christmas tunes on the piano.

    After mixing and mingling for a bit, people were greeted by Barb House and Nancy Van Dyke. House led a prayer over the holiday meal and Van Dyke thanked the Boothbay Harbor Hannaford and Newcastle Chrysler for donating to Toys for Tots.

    “You guys all matter and because you do, that’s why we’re doing this,” said Van Dyke. “So welcome and enjoy your dinner.”

    Added House, “As my youngest grandson would say, ‘Dig in!’”
